Q: Compaction stalled on the Quillpipe message queue — what now?

A: Check the compactor lag metric first. If segments older than 48h remain, the compactor likely crashed mid-pass; restart it and it resumes from the checkpoint. Do not delete segment files manually — consumers may still hold offsets into them. If the checkpoint itself is corrupt, trigger a checkpoint rebuild from the admin shell, which will prompt for the on-call recovery passphrase given below.

unlock words, hahip-baduf: holwyn-istath-julvan

# Planner Regression Env Notes

Hey reviewer — after the Quillbase 4.2 upgrade, the query planner regressed on wide joins, so we added `PLANNER_LEGACY_MODE=1` as a temporary escape hatch. It's read at boot by the Fernwick API. To reproduce the regression locally against the shared test cluster, your env file needs this entry:

sealed setting: ARCHIVE_KEY3=8d0

Ticket: Splitline assignment service failing auth since Tuesday. The Bucketeer credential expired and experiments are falling back to control for all traffic. Reviewer: please confirm the client reads the key from config, not the hardcoded constant in assigner.go. Rotation is done on the Forkwise side. The replacement key for the fix branch follows below.

gateway credential: kto3_qfe

## Onboarding — Markdown Pipeline (Inkmere)

Inkmere docs render through a three-stage pipeline: parse, sanitize, emit. Releases rebuild all templates; never hot-patch emitted HTML. Broken renders usually mean a sanitizer rule change — check the rules diff first. The render cluster only accepts builds from the release channel, and every build artifact must be signed before upload. Sign artifacts with the deploy key below.

release key, hafop-tajef: bky13_s2vaFVNJTHfBL